LAS VEGAS, NEV.– As round two of the women's golf Big West Championship concludes, the UC Davis Aggies remain in fifth place. Three Aggies occupy the top-20, one of which includes a top-5 seed. The Ags shot for a second-round score of 17-over 305 on Monday and overall have a two-round score of 31-over 607.
Skyler May paced for the Ags as she is tied for 4
th and remains in the top-5 of the Big West Championships. The sophomore carded three birdies and finished the second round at 2-over 74. May has a two-round score of 3-over 147.
Elle Rastvortsev and
Naomi Danner both finished in the top-20 after round-two, coincidentally both tied for 16
th.
Rastvortsev had the best round for the Ags, as the sophomore carded a 2-under 70 and fired for three birdies. Danner carded a birdie on the day, but finished the round at 8-over 80. Currently in the 16
th spot, the sophomores have a two-round score of 8-over 152.
Freshman
Lauren Calderon finished the second-round tied for 32
nd. Calderon fired for a pair of birdies, but would finish the day 9-over 81. Overall, Calderon has a two-round score of 15-over 159.
Abby Leighton rounds out the Ags as she is tied for 35
th after round-two. The sophomore carded a single birdie and ended the day at 9-over 81. In total, Leighton has a two-round score of 16-over 160
UC Davis returns to the Spanish Trail course for the third and final round of the Big West Championship tomorrow, Tuesday, April 17
